How much does a computer science tutor cost?

The average cost of a computer science tutor typically ranges from $25 to $80 per hour, but this can vary widely depending on several factors. Location, tutor experience, and the complexity of the subject matter all play a role in determining the final price. For instance, a tutor in a major metropolitan area with years of industry experience might charge the higher end of this range.

It's important to note that while cost is a significant factor, it shouldn't be the only consideration when choosing a tutor. The quality of instruction, the tutor's teaching style, and their ability to explain complex concepts in an understandable way are all crucial elements that can impact the value you receive from tutoring sessions.

Is online tutoring cheaper than in-person tutoring?

Online tutoring is generally more affordable than in-person tutoring, with rates typically ranging from $20 to $50 per hour for online sessions. This price difference is often due to reduced overhead costs for online tutors, who don't need to factor in travel time or expenses.

Many students find online tutoring very effective due to the convenience and the use of digital tools that can enhance the learning experience. Screen sharing, interactive whiteboards, and instant messaging can all contribute to a rich, collaborative learning environment.

What should I look for in a computer science tutor?

When choosing a computer science tutor, it's important to look for someone who can meet your budget, availability, and learning needs. Look for the following:

  • Qualifications and expertise: Seek tutors with strong academic backgrounds in computer science, such as degrees from reputable universities or relevant industry experience. Advanced degrees (master's or Ph.D.) and teaching experience can be particularly valuable.
  • Subject knowledge: Ensure the tutor has expertise in the specific areas of computer science you need help with, whether it's programming languages, algorithms, data structures, or other specialized topics.
  • Teaching style: Look for a tutor who can adapt their teaching approach to match your learning style. They should be patient, able to break down complex concepts, and willing to use different explanations or examples if you're struggling.
  • Experience: Consider tutors who have experience teaching or tutoring computer science topics, as they'll likely be more adept at explaining difficult concepts.
  • Availability and scheduling: Choose a tutor whose availability aligns with your schedule and who can provide consistent, regular sessions.
  • Reviews and recommendations: If possible, read reviews from other students on Tutors.com or Google and seek recommendations from peers or professors.

What questions should I ask a computer science tutor?

Ask these questions during your initial discussions to gauge the tutor's qualifications and compatibility with your learning style:

  • What is your educational background in computer science? How long have you been tutoring this subject?
  • Which specific areas of computer science are you most experienced in teaching (e.g., programming languages, algorithms, data structures, etc.)?
  • How do you typically structure your tutoring sessions? Can you adapt your teaching style to different learning preferences?
  • What resources or tools do you use during tutoring sessions to enhance learning?
  • What is your availability for regular tutoring sessions? Are you flexible with scheduling?
  • What are your tutoring rates? Do you offer any package deals for multiple sessions?
  • Can you share any examples of how you've helped previous students improve their understanding of computer science concepts?
  • Do you have experience tutoring for specific courses or preparing students for particular exams or certifications?
